Overview
- Both wildfires remain active on July 9 with perimeters gradually fixed after days of aerial and ground firefighting.
- More than 500 firefighters in the Aude and 168 in Bouches-du-Rhône continue to battle hot spots, supported by Canadair, Dash planes and helicopters.
- The A9 and A55 motorways are still closed and Marseille-Provence airport remains shut, forcing flight diversions and road disruptions.
- Evacuation and confinement orders persist across Narbonne’s Roche-Grise and Montplaisir quarters, Jas de Rode and Bouroumettes zones in Pennes-Mirabeau, and Marseille’s 16th arrondissement.
- Judicial investigations are under way to determine the causes of the woodland fire in the Corbières and the vehicle fire that ignited the Marseille-area blaze.
